SanDisk Launches Pro Cinema Type A CFExpress Media Cards

SanDisk has launched its PRO-CINEMA line of Type A CFExpress Media Cards, designed specifically for professional videographers and content creators who demand both speed and durability in their storage solutions.

These high-performance media cards support video capture at resolutions up to 8K, making them ideal for filmmakers looking to enhance video quality and efficiency.

Leveraging the advanced PCIe Gen 4 protocol, the SanDisk PRO CINEMA Type A media cards achieve exceptional write speeds of up to 1650 MB/s and read speeds up to 1800 MB/s.

This remarkable performance enables rapid file transfers and smooth content capture during extended recording sessions.

Offered in two capacities – 480GB and 960GB – these cards meet the rigorous demands of professional video production, where both speed and storage capacity are crucial.

Certified by the Compact Flash Association, the media cards are designed for consistent and reliable performance necessary for high-resolution video recording.

They handle data-intensive applications without dropped frames, ensuring a seamless recording experience.

This reliability is vital in the fast-paced environment of video production, where every moment is critical.

Physically, the SanDisk PRO CINEMA Type A CFExpress Media Cards measure 0.79 x 1.1 x 0.11 inches (20 x 28 x 2.8 mm) and weigh only 0.13 ounces (3.69 grams), making them lightweight and portable.

They are built to endure harsh conditions, featuring drop protection for falls from over 24 feet (7.5 meters), bend resistance up to 150 newtons, and an IP57 rating for water and dust protection.

The operational temperature range is broad, functioning effectively between -13°F to 185°F (-25°C to 85°C), allowing creators to use the cards in diverse environments.

To enhance the user experience, SanDisk includes up to two years of RescuePro Deluxe Data Recovery software with the cards, helping recover accidentally deleted or corrupted files.

They come with a limited lifetime warranty, though some regions like Germany and Canada have a 30-year limitation due to local regulations.

Pricing for the SanDisk PRO CINEMA Type A CFExpress Media Cards starts at $290.99 for the 480GB version and $518.99 for the 960GB version.
